Known Broadway Suc- corm 439 Fairfax The Crucible of Life With Powerful Climaxes Developed ‘ i a BE THE CASPER DAILY TRIBUNE 1 ‘PASSENGER RATE OVER WESTERN RONDS GIVEN SLIGHT BOOST, CLAIM: BILLINGS, Mont.—A slight raise in railroad passenger rates is an- nounced in new passenger tariffs of the United States railroad adminis- tration issued to both the Northern Pacific and Burlington railroads here. The higher rates are now in effect. These new tariffs do away with | been termed the short mile. Ss, largely employed in bas- ing preient passenger fares. It has been customary to base a fare on the | shortest mileage between two points. For instance, the Burlington has two routes from Billings to Denver, Colo., one by way of Sheridan, Wyo., the} other by way of Casper, Wyo. The old fare was 3 cents a mile for the! shorter route by way of Casper. The Northern -Pacific fare to St.| Paul i: d upen the Chicago, Mil- waukee & St. Paul mileage, which is shorter. Q., $36.66 to $41.85,/ Deny via Sheridan, $19.81 to: $21.40; Denver, via Casper and Che~ enne, $19.81 to $20.14, While the new rates in practically every instance tend to increase the cost of travel over lines affected, a reduction of 2 per cent is granted in Pullman tariffs. The present tax of 10 per cent will be lowered to 8 per cent.
